/**
 * @file
 * This file contains the canvas object which is the part where the widgets
 * draw (temporally) images on.
 */

#ifndef GUI_AUXILIARY_CANVAS_HPP_INCLUDED
#define GUI_AUXILIARY_CANVAS_HPP_INCLUDED

#include "formula_callable.hpp"
#include "sdl_utils.hpp"

class config;
class variant;

namespace gui2
{

/**
 * A simple canvas which can be drawn upon.
 *
 * The class has a config which contains what to draw.
 *
 * NOTE we might add some caching in a later state, for now every draw cycle
 * does a full redraw.
 *
 * The copy constructor does a shallow copy of the shapes to draw.
 * a clone() will be implemented if really needed.
 */
class tcanvas
{
public:
	/**
	 * Abstract base class for all other shapes.
	 *
	 * The other shapes are declared and defined in canvas.cpp, since the
	 * implementation details are not interesting for users of the canvas.
	 */
	class tshape : public reference_counted_object
	{
	public:
		virtual ~tshape()
		{
		}

		/**
		 * Draws the canvas.
		 *
		 * @param canvas          The resulting image will be blitted upon this
		 *                        canvas.
		 * @param variables       The canvas can have formulas in it's
		 *                        definition, this parameter contains the values
		 *                        for these formulas.
		 */
		virtual void draw(surface& canvas,
						  const game_logic::map_formula_callable& variables)
				= 0;
	};

	typedef boost::intrusive_ptr<tshape> tshape_ptr;
	typedef boost::intrusive_ptr<const tshape> const_tshape_ptr;

	tcanvas();

	/**
	 * Draws the canvas.
	 *
	 * @param force               If the canvas isn't dirty it isn't redrawn
	 *                            unless force is set to true.
	 */
	void draw(const bool force = false);

	/**
	 * Blits the canvas unto another surface.
	 *
	 * It makes sure the image on the canvas is up to date. Also executes the
	 * pre-blitting functions.
	 *
	 * @param surf                The surface to blit upon.
	 * @param rect                The place to blit to.
	 */
	void blit(surface& surf, SDL_Rect rect);

	/**
	 * Sets the config.
	 *
	 * @param cfg                 The config object with the data to draw, see
	 *                            http://www.wesnoth.org/wiki/GUICanvasWML for
	 *                            more information.
	 */
	void set_cfg(const config& cfg)
	{
		parse_cfg(cfg);
	}

	/***** ***** ***** setters / getters for members ***** ****** *****/

	void set_width(const unsigned width)
	{
		w_ = width;
		set_is_dirty(true);
	}
	unsigned get_width() const
	{
		return w_;
	}

	void set_height(const unsigned height)
	{
		h_ = height;
		set_is_dirty(true);
	}
	unsigned get_height() const
	{
		return h_;
	}

	surface& surf()
	{
		return canvas_;
	}

	void set_variable(const std::string& key, const variant& value)
	{
		variables_.add(key, value);
		set_is_dirty(true);
	}

private:
	/** Vector with the shapes to draw. */
	std::vector<tshape_ptr> shapes_;

	/**
	 * The depth of the blur to use in the pre committing.
	 *
	 * @note at the moment there's one pre commit function, namely the
	 * blurring so use a variable here, might get more functions in the
	 * future. When that happens need to evaluate whether variables are the
	 * best thing to use.
	 */
	unsigned blur_depth_;

	/** Width of the canvas. */
	unsigned w_;

	/** Height of the canvas. */
	unsigned h_;

	/** The surface we draw all items on. */
	surface canvas_;

	/** The variables of the canvas. */
	game_logic::map_formula_callable variables_;

	/** The dirty state of the canvas. */
	bool is_dirty_;

	void set_is_dirty(const bool is_dirty)
	{
		is_dirty_ = is_dirty;
	}

	/**
	 * Parses a config object.
	 *
	 * The config object is parsed and serialized by this function after which
	 * the config object is no longer required and thus not stored in the
	 * object.
	 *
	 * @param cfg                 The config object with the data to draw, see
	 *                            http://www.wesnoth.org/wiki/GUICanvasWML
	 */
	void parse_cfg(const config& cfg);
};

} // namespace gui2

#endif
